Transaction 31c56e0f013a3101c833d01ab76085051900c30678e15b0d6dc31eae71fa0564
1 Input
1 Output
-
31c56e0f013a3101c833d01ab76085051900c30678e15b0d6dc31eae71fa0564:0
- value
- 70881
- script pubkey
- OP_0 OP_PUSHBYTES_20 83a6ebaa900ce422915230653b7e4d901db400df
- address
- bc1qswnwh25spnjz9y2jxpjnkljdjqwmgqxlp27a0d